 In the meantime, would it be possible to improve a bit the sentence and
 link for the Classic Editor please?

 `Need to use the old editor? [link]Learn how[/link]`

 "Learn how" is equivalent to links like "Read more" or "Click here". It
 doesn't make much sense when read out of context. Worth reminding
 assistive technologies have tools to jump through links, list all the
 links in a page, etc. Landing on a link that tells only "Learn how" is
 less than ideal for users who need it the most. Ideally the link should
 include the _what_ and tell users something like:

 `[link]Learn how to use the old editor.[/link]`

 or something along those lines. I'd tend to think the previous sentence
 should be adjusted to adapt to the new link.

 Additionally, if this link is now going to open the Classic Editor plugin
 details modal, that's a problem. Modals have accessibility issues. The
 ones in core still need improvements and using a modal here is not so
 ideal, considering it's very likely this link will be used by persons with
 accessibility needs. I'd suggest to link to the add new plugin page,
 Classic Editor is now in the Featured tab: `wp-admin/plugin-
 install.php?tab=featured`.
